Understanding Physical Closeness
Physical closeness can manifest in various ways – holding hands, hugging, cuddling or even just sitting close together. It’s essential to remember that every individual has different comfort levels when it comes to physical closeness. Respecting these boundaries is vital for creating a relaxed atmosphere where both parties feel comfortable.

Communication: The Key to Comfortable Physical Closeness
Open and honest communication is the backbone of a healthy relationship where one can feel comfortable engaging in physical closeness without any pressure. Talking about each other’s comfort levels, expressing feelings, needs, and desires are essential steps towards establishing a mutually satisfying level of intimacy.
Here are some tips for effective communication on this matter:
1. Create a Safe Space: Always initiate conversations in an open and non-judgmental environment where both parties feel comfortable to share their thoughts, feelings and concerns about physical closeness.
2. Be Specific: Instead of using general terms like “touching” or “cuddling,” be specific about what you’re looking for so that your partner can understand your expectations better.
3. Listen Actively: Pay attention to how your partner feels, and try to empathize with their perspective while communicating yours. This will help in understanding each other’s comfort levels better.
4. Regular Check-ins: Physical closeness may evolve over time as relationships develop, so regular check-ins can ensure that both parties are still comfortable with the level of physical intimacy they share.
Establishing Healthy Boundaries
Boundaries play a crucial role in enjoying physical closeness without pressure. They give individuals control over when and how much physical contact is appropriate for them, thus creating a safe space where both parties can feel at ease. Here are some ways to establish healthy boundaries:
1. Establish Consent: Ensure that any form of touch between you and your partner has been given mutual consent. This way, each party will be aware of what is expected from them before engaging in physical intimacy.
2. Respect Individual Boundaries: Understand the comfort levels of both parties involved when it comes to physical closeness. Always respect these boundaries and never push someone beyond their limits.
3. Encourage Expression: Create an environment where individuals feel comfortable sharing their thoughts on what they consider appropriate physical contact, thereby allowing open dialogue about personal preferences.
4. Be Flexible: Keep in mind that as relationships evolve, boundaries may shift accordingly. Always be willing to adapt and reassess these limits so both parties remain at ease with the level of closeness shared between them.
